NEPAL FACING SECOND STAGE OF CORONA INFECTION
Nepal is in lockdown to defend the pandemics of Corona. It is time for doing good to check pandemics for all. So, people also should obey all measures of precautions.
After being
two-month-long stability the first stage of corona infection, Nepal has entered
the second stage that is the stage before the community infection of
coronavirus. In total nine people infected so far in Nepal, the first case was identified
on 15 February. The hope to check in the first stage is become fade is unlucky for Nepal. Among 9 cases one has already got well as cured.
The meaning of
the second stage is the risk of infection is growing a little high, although, the
situation is not still out of control. Nepal had not any other option beyond
the lockdown of the country and declares it on 24 March. It was a hard decision but also a compulsory step for a small and poor country to protect the people from the corona.

The people are following
the lockdown and they are passing time in their residences for the last two
weeks. It is very hard to pass time without doing anything. Economic
activities are stopped; a few essential supplies are running but not smoothly.
Roads are empty except police vans and ambulances. People are losing their
earning activities; lower classes need assistance for food and security. About
25 percent of people still under the poverty line in the country, this class in urban is in sever problem this time.
The eighteen hundred kilometer-long border between Nepal and India
was traditionally and publicly open but it is sealed during the lockdown. India
also is running under lockdown to prevent infection of coronavirus this time,
meantime thousands of Nepali laborers in India returning home are stranded
behind the borderline is a painful issue for Nepal. Such people who had already
come to Nepal, among them few have corona infected. India and Nepal both have
reciprocally decided to manage stranded people in the border, to protect the
man as the basis of where is who. India also suffering from the growing
corona infection is also a concern for Nepal.
